Quick update on the EGT gauge that fits in the hazard switch receptacle:
You will recall that I was waiting on some custom filament to be made, and tracking down some quality EGT probes.
Well, one out of two ain't bad. I received the first batch of probes last week. They are an Iconel body (more durable than stainless steel), with a short body to fit into the tight-ish space post Turbo, and they are of the exposed junction type, so much faster acting that the $10 cheapies kicking around on ebay.
As for the window, I have devised another way of making a nice window for the display, so I'm ready to begin production.
